Savanna's Credit Facility Extended Due to Low Prices

Savanna Energy Services Corp. has announced that Savanna's syndicate of lenders have approved the renewal and extension of its senior secured credit facility and amendments to the financial covenants related thereto.
The renewal, extension, and financial covenant amendments provide Savanna with increased financial flexibility amidst the prevailing uncertain market conditions.
Savanna's senior secured revolving credit facility remains comprised of a $220 million Canadian syndicated facility, a $10 million Australian facility, and a $20 million Canadian operating facility.
